#e968b2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e968b2 is composed of 91.4% red, 40.8%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.4% magenta, 23.6%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 325.6 degrees, a saturation of 74.6% and a lightness of 66.1%. #e968b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d0ff with #d30065.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

Shades and Tints of #e968b2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030002 is the darkest color, while #fdf1f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e968b2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#ada4a9 is the less saturated color, while #fd54b5 is the most saturated one.
